Hertzberger","doi":"10.5220/0002683800490062","DOIUrl":"https://doi.org/10.5220/0002683800490062","url":null,"abstract":"Distributed information management plays a fundamental role within the base infrastructure supporting the elderly care domain. Specificities of this domain include the autonomy and independence of its involved actors, the critical data that is handled about individuals, and the variety of hardware/software resources supporting the elderly care environment. A federated information management system coping with these requirements is designed and integrated as a core component of a mobile agent-based infrastructure, to support collaborative networks for elderly care. Functionalities for: federated schema management, federated query processing, HW/SW resource management, specification and enforcement of visibility/access rights to data and resources, and an ontology-based automatic schema generation facility are introduced, and their implementation details are briefly discussed.","PeriodicalId":319584,"journal":{"name":"Tele-Care and Collaborative Virtual Communities in Elderly Care","volume":"119 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1900-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"122056745","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Charpillet","doi":"10.5220/0002680500970108","DOIUrl":"https://doi.org/10.5220/0002680500970108","url":null,"abstract":"This paper describes a monitoring system prototype dedicated to fall prevention for elderly. Our system designed in collaboration with physicians, aims at assessing the risk that a fall occurs, relying on the signature of the walk. The signature is defined as a set of relevant characteristics, computed from the observation through a video camera of the behavior at home of the elderly and can be viewed as a self reference for the telecared person. We model the deviation of this signature to determine an increase of the fall risk.","PeriodicalId":319584,"journal":{"name":"Tele-Care and Collaborative Virtual Communities in Elderly Care","volume":"22 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1900-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"133266877","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
